import ClawdbotKit
import Foundation
import OSLog
import WebKit
private let canvasLogger = Logger(subsystem: "com.clawdbot", category: "Canvas")
final class CanvasSchemeHandler: NSObject, WKURLSchemeHandler {
private let root: URL
init(root: URL) {
self.root = root
}
func webView(_: WKWebView, start urlSchemeTask: WKURLSchemeTask) {
guard let url = urlSchemeTask.request.url else {
urlSchemeTask.didFailWithError(NSError(domain: "Canvas", code: 1, userInfo: [
NSLocalizedDescriptionKey: "missing url",
]))
return
}
let response = self.response(for: url)
let mime = response.mime
let data = response.data
let encoding = self.textEncodingName(forMimeType: mime)
let urlResponse = URLResponse(
url: url,
mimeType: mime,
expectedContentLength: data.count,
textEncodingName: encoding)
urlSchemeTask.didReceive(urlResponse)
urlSchemeTask.didReceive(data)
urlSchemeTask.didFinish()
}
func webView(_: WKWebView, stop _: WKURLSchemeTask) {
// no-op
}
private struct CanvasResponse {
let mime: String
let data: Data
}
private func response(for url: URL) -> CanvasResponse {
guard url.scheme == CanvasScheme.scheme else {
return self.html("Invalid scheme.")
}
guard let session = url.host, !session.isEmpty else {
return self.html("Missing session.")
}
// Keep session component safe; don't allow slashes or traversal.
if session.contains("/") || session.contains("..") {
return self.html("Invalid session.")
}
let sessionRoot = self.root.appendingPathComponent(session, isDirectory: true)
// Path mapping: request path maps directly into the session dir.
var path = url.path
if let qIdx = path.firstIndex(of: "?") { path = String(path[..<qIdx]) }
if path.hasPrefix("/") { path.removeFirst() }
path = path.removingPercentEncoding ?? path
// Special-case: welcome page when root index is missing.
if path.isEmpty {
let indexA = sessionRoot.appendingPathComponent("index.html", isDirectory: false)
let indexB = sessionRoot.appendingPathComponent("index.htm", isDirectory: false)
if !FileManager().fileExists(atPath: indexA.path),
!FileManager().fileExists(atPath: indexB.path)
{
return self.scaffoldPage(sessionRoot: sessionRoot)
}
}
let resolved = self.resolveFileURL(sessionRoot: sessionRoot, requestPath: path)
guard let fileURL = resolved else {
return self.html("Not Found", title: "Canvas: 404")
}
// Directory traversal guard: served files must live under the session root.
let standardizedRoot = sessionRoot.standardizedFileURL
let standardizedFile = fileURL.standardizedFileURL
guard standardizedFile.path.hasPrefix(standardizedRoot.path) else {
return self.html("Forbidden", title: "Canvas: 403")
}
do {
let data = try Data(contentsOf: standardizedFile)
let mime = CanvasScheme.mimeType(forExtension: standardizedFile.pathExtension)
let servedPath = standardizedFile.path
canvasLogger.debug(
"served \(session, privacy: .public)/\(path, privacy: .public) -> \(servedPath, privacy: .public)")
return CanvasResponse(mime: mime, data: data)
} catch {
let failedPath = standardizedFile.path
let errorText = error.localizedDescription
canvasLogger
.error(
"failed reading \(failedPath, privacy: .public): \(errorText, privacy: .public)")
return self.html("Failed to read file.", title: "Canvas error")
}
}
private func resolveFileURL(sessionRoot: URL, requestPath: String) -> URL? {
let fm = FileManager()
var candidate = sessionRoot.appendingPathComponent(requestPath, isDirectory: false)
var isDir: ObjCBool = false
if fm.fileExists(atPath: candidate.path, isDirectory: &isDir) {
if isDir.boolValue {
if let idx = self.resolveIndex(in: candidate) { return idx }
return nil
}
return candidate
}
// Directory index behavior:
// - "/yolo" serves "<yolo>/index.html" if that directory exists.
if !requestPath.isEmpty, !requestPath.hasSuffix("/") {
candidate = sessionRoot.appendingPathComponent(requestPath, isDirectory: true)
if fm.fileExists(atPath: candidate.path, isDirectory: &isDir), isDir.boolValue {
if let idx = self.resolveIndex(in: candidate) { return idx }
}
}
// Root fallback:
// - "/" serves "<sessionRoot>/index.html" if present.
if requestPath.isEmpty {
return self.resolveIndex(in: sessionRoot)
}
return nil
}
private func resolveIndex(in dir: URL) -> URL? {
let fm = FileManager()
let a = dir.appendingPathComponent("index.html", isDirectory: false)
if fm.fileExists(atPath: a.path) { return a }
let b = dir.appendingPathComponent("index.htm", isDirectory: false)
if fm.fileExists(atPath: b.path) { return b }
return nil
}
